Udupi rains: DC declares holiday for schools, colleges on July 5
Team Udayavani, Jul 5, 2022, 7:59 AM IST
Udupi: The Udupi District Deputy Commissioner Kurma Rao M has declared a holiday for schools and colleges on Tuesday, July 5.
The heavy downpour continued unabated on Monday night prompting the district administration to declare a holiday as a precaution.
Officials in Udupi have been asked to stay alert as incessant rainfall in the past two days and warnings of more wet days ahead have triggered fears of floods.
